게시판을 이용해 주셔서 감사합니다.
다음양식에 맞게 입력해주세요.
**필수입력사항**
* 고객(업체)명 : LIG Nex1
* 제품 버전 : 4.0
* 문의 유형(질문/요청/참조) : 질문
* 내용 :
부모창의 그리드에서 Edit 상태를 만들어 수정을 한 뒤 onExit 이벤트를 통해 팝업창으로 수정 된 라인 전체의
데이터를 전달 할 수 있는 방법을 문의 드립니다.
빠른 확인 부탁드립니다.
안녕하세요.
문의하신 내용을 아래의 두가지로 구분하여 답변드리겠습니다.
1. 데이터셋에서 수정 된 Row의 데이터들을 필터링 하는 방법
2. 데이터셋을 다른 데이터셋으로 값을 넣는 방법
1. 데이터셋을 필터링 하는 방법은 DataSet.Filter 메소드를 통하여 구현이 가능합니다.
문의하신 수정 된 Row의 데이터들을 필터링 하는 방법은 DataSet.OnFilter 이벤트에서
DataSet.SysStatus 를 필터링 조건으로 필터링 처리를 하시면 됩니다.
참고 URL
http://member.shift.co.kr/ComponentManual/UMX/Basic/DataSet/Method/Filter/Filter.htm
http://member.shift.co.kr/ComponentManual/UMX/Basic/DataSet/Event/OnFilter/OnFilter.htm
http://member.shift.co.kr/ComponentManual/UMX/Basic/DataSet/Method/SysStatus/SysStatus.htm
예)
if(tb_DataSet.SysStatus(row) != 0 && tb_DataSet.SysStatus(row) != 4)
return true;
else
return false;
2. 데이터셋을 다른 데이터셋으로 값을 넣는 방법은 DataSet.ExportData, DataSet.ImportData 메소드를 이용하여 구현이 가능합니다.
참고URL
http://member.shift.co.kr/ComponentManual/UMX/Basic/DataSet/Method/ImportData/ImportData.htm
http://member.shift.co.kr/ComponentManual/UMX/Basic/DataSet/Method/ExportData/ExportData.htm
문의하신 데이터셋에서 수정 된 Row의 데이터들을 필터링 해서 다른 데이터셋으로 값을 넣는 방법은
우선 수정된 로우들에 대하여 필터링 처리하신 후
데이터셋을 export 하여 다른 데이터셋으로 import 하여 처리하시면 됩니다.
관련 샘플 첨부하여 드립니다.
감사합니다.
|
질문을 바꾸겠습니다.
데이터셋에서 수정 된 Row의 데이터들을 필터링 해서 다른 데이터셋으로 값을 넣는 방법을 알려주셨으면 합니다.
전달 된 데이터셋을 그대로 팝업창에서 활용하려 합니다.